Thanks to our friends at the Portland International Film Festival, we've managed to score a pair of tickets to what's arguably Portland's biggest event of the year: The world premiere of Coraline.

coraline photo.jpg

Coraline is the first feature film from Portland's LAIKA studios. This isn't some "Portland" premiere -- it's an Honest-to-Goodness WORLD PREMIERE, in 3D to boot! We're talking movie stars, red carpet, the whole shebang. It's the Opening Night Gala of the 32nd Portland International Film Festival, presented by the Northwest Film Center.

Did I mention it's also totally sold out? There are NO extra tickets floating around out there. There are NO giveaways happening... except this one.

As Rod Blagojevich might say, we're sitting on gold here. But the only thing we're extorting from you is your poetry.

Your mission: Write a haiku about Coraline.

It can be about anyone or anything connected to the film, including (but certainly not limited to) Dakota Fanning, Neil Gaiman, John Hodgman, Teri Hatcher, or Phil Knight, just for starters. You can write a haiku inspired by the novella if you'd like.

You have until 8:00 pm PST on Tuesday, February 3rd to leave a comment on this entry containing your Coraline haiku. The best haiku wins.

(Reminder: Haikus should have three lines, of 5, 7, and 5 syllables, respectively.)

Important details:

The winner will be chosen by a blue-ribbon panel of KGW judges and notified on Wednesday, February 4. The decision of the judges is final. The winner will receive two (2) tickets to the Coraline world premiere at the Arlene Schnitzer Concert Hall at 7:30 pm on Thursday, February 5. You'll need to pick up your tickets at the PCPA Box Office by 6:00 pm on Thursday.

You MUST leave a valid e-mail address with your entry. Only one entry per person, so make it a good one. Multiple entries or sock puppetry will cause all your entries to be disqualified. KGW employees and immediate family members aren't eligible. That just wouldn't be fair.
